WebWet grass will stick to the dethatcher and force the blades to pull the grass unevenly. It’ll remove healthy, fresh grass rather than the thatch layer. Scarifying should rejuvenate your lawn, not shred it apart. Morning dew or high humidity can also cause this common issue. Mow the lawn to 2 to 2.5 inches to ensure the best scarifying depth.

Once this is done, overseed and water the lawn after scarifying it. irish life planet interactiveWebWhen should you not scarify your lawn? October - Often considered the best month to scarify your lawn, it is in fact rather late. Temperatures drop and green growth starts slowing down. The wet weather combined with the cold often creates large patches of bare soil, which barely recover as is.
